Andrew Craig’s Gospel Christmas Project – the most rousing, inspiring, and uplifting concert of the Holiday season – returns to Guelph’s River Run Centre for the fourth time – and farewell show!
Originally created in 2006 as a CBC Radio and TV special (which received a Gemini nomination), the Gospel Christmas Project has been performed across Southern Ontario, including at Toronto’s legendary Massey Hall, and twice with the National Arts Centre Orchestra in Ottawa.
The Gospel Christmas Project takes the world’s most-loved Christmas carols, and performs them in the electrifying style of contemporary Gospel. For this final concert, Andrew brings together the cast that started it all: Jackie Richardson (Canada’s Queen of Jazz and Blues), Kellylee Evans (2011 Juno award Female Jazz Vocalist of the Year), Toya Alexis (former Canadian Idol finalist), powerhouse vocalist Alana Bridgewater, and dazzling Gospel vocalist Chris Lowe. Add to that mix Grammy-nominated Sharon Riley and Faith Chorale, and the top-notch band, all under Andrew’s direction, and you have the perfect recipe for an unforgettable night of music and celebration.
